If 0,<, or = should replace the blank in k___k^2

Mathematics
1 answer:
Setler79 [48]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

if 0<k<1

then k>k^2

if k=0 or 1 then k=k^2

if k>1,then k< k^2

Please help I been waiting for hours and I need to find out how to simplify complex fractions.
schepotkina [342]

Answer:

Method 1:

Find the Least Common Denominator (LCD) of all the denominators in the complex fractions.

Multiply this LCD to the numerator and denominator of the complex fraction.

Simplify, if necessary.

Method 2:

Create a single fraction in the numerator and denominator.

Apply the division rule of fractions by multiplying the numerator by the reciprocal or inverse of the denominator.

Simplify, if necessary.
